Web22 jul. 2024 · Is the thermosphere hot or cold? The thermosphere lies between the exosphere and the mesosphere. “Thermo” means heat and the temperature in this layer can reach up to 4 500 degrees Fahrenheit. If you were to hang out in the thermosphere though you would be very coldbecause there aren’t enough gas molecules to transfer the heat to …
